From source file:demo.BarChartDemo11.java
/** * Creates a sample chart.// w ww .j ava 2 s . c o m * * @param dataset the dataset. * * @return The chart. */ private static JFreeChart createChart(CategoryDataset dataset) { // create the chart... JFreeChart chart = ChartFactory.createBarChart("Open Source Projects By License", "License", "Percent", dataset); chart.removeLegend(); TextTitle source = new TextTitle( "Source: http://www.blackducksoftware.com/resources/data/top-20-licenses (as at 30 Aug 2013)", new Font("Dialog", Font.PLAIN, 9)); source.setPosition(RectangleEdge.BOTTOM); chart.addSubtitle(source); // get a reference to the plot for further customisation... CategoryPlot plot = (CategoryPlot) chart.getPlot(); plot.setOrientation(PlotOrientation.HORIZONTAL); plot.setDomainGridlinesVisible(true); plot.getDomainAxis().setMaximumCategoryLabelWidthRatio(0.8f); // set the range axis to display integers only... NumberAxis rangeAxis = (NumberAxis) plot.getRangeAxis(); rangeAxis.setStandardTickUnits(NumberAxis.createIntegerTickUnits()); // disable bar outlines... BarRenderer renderer = (BarRenderer) plot.getRenderer(); renderer.setDrawBarOutline(false); StandardCategoryToolTipGenerator tt = new StandardCategoryToolTipGenerator("{1}: {2} percent", new DecimalFormat("0")); renderer.setBaseToolTipGenerator(tt); // set up gradient paints for series... GradientPaint gp0 = new GradientPaint(0.0f, 0.0f, Color.BLUE, 0.0f, 0.0f, new Color(0, 0, 64)); renderer.setSeriesPaint(0, gp0); return chart; }

From source file:com.ewcms.plugin.report.generate.service.chart.ChartGenerationService.java
/** * ?/*from w ww .j a va 2 s . co m*/ * * @param title * @param titleFont * @param categoryAxisLabel * @param valueAxisLabel * @param data ?? * @param orientation ? * @param legend * @param tooltips ???? * @param urls ??URL * @param urlGenerator * * @return ? */ public static JFreeChart createBarChart(String title, java.awt.Font titleFont, String categoryAxisLabel, String valueAxisLabel, CategoryDataset data, PlotOrientation orientation, boolean legend, boolean tooltips, boolean urls, CategoryURLGenerator urlGenerator) { CategoryAxis categoryAxis = new CategoryAxis(categoryAxisLabel); ValueAxis valueAxis = new NumberAxis(valueAxisLabel); BarRenderer renderer = new BarRenderer(); if (tooltips) { // renderer.setToolTipGenerator(new StandardCategoryToolTipGenerator()); renderer.setBaseToolTipGenerator(new StandardCategoryToolTipGenerator()); } if (urls) { // renderer.setItemURLGenerator(urlGenerator); renderer.setBaseItemURLGenerator(urlGenerator); } CategoryPlot plot = new CategoryPlot(data, categoryAxis, valueAxis, renderer); plot.setOrientation(orientation); JFreeChart chart = new JFreeChart(title, titleFont, plot, legend); return chart; }
